What does the Rule of Twelfths help estimate in tidal planning?

Explanation:
The idea behind this rule is to have a quick, practical way to estimate how high the water will be as a tide comes in or goes out, without needing a full tide chart. The tide’s rise (or fall) isn’t perfectly linear, but it tends to follow a recognizable pattern over the six hours between low and high tide: about a twelfth, then two twelfths, then three twelfths, then three twelfths again, then two twelfths, and finally one twelfth of the total range. Put another way, you start at the low water and add those fractions of the total tidal range as time passes; after six hours you’ve added the whole range and reached high water. This lets you estimate, for any given hour after low tide (or after high tide), roughly how deep the water will be in shallow channels or at exposed ledges—very handy for planning paddling routes in Maine’s tidal waters. Keep in mind it’s a rough rule of thumb, not a precise measurement. Wind, barometric pressure, and local shallow areas can push actual depths away from the estimate, so use it alongside real tide tables and local observations for safer planning.
